Deterministic Matching Algorithms

Deterministic matching algorithms ensure that the order of trades is processed in a strictly predictable and consistent manner based on specific criteria like price, time, and size. In high-stakes derivative markets, these algorithms must be robust to prevent front-running or unfair prioritization of specific market participants.

By using deterministic logic, exchanges provide a transparent framework where every trader knows exactly how their order will be handled relative to others. This predictability is essential for maintaining trust in centralized and decentralized trading venues.

Any deviation from these rules could lead to accusations of market manipulation or systemic unfairness.
